Abstract
OBJECTIVE: To evaluate associations between binge-eating disorder (BED) and somatic illnesses and determine whether medical comorbidities are more common in individuals who present with BED and comorbid obesity.Entities:

N (%) of individuals with each somatic illness by group (case = 850; control = 8,500) and results of conditional logistic regressions evaluating the association of binge‐eating disorder (BED) with each somatic illness [OR (95% CI)], and adjusted for lifetime psychiatric comorbidity [AOR (95% CI)]
| Somatic Illness Category | BED (Cases) N (%) | Controls | OR (95% CI) |
| AOR (95% CI) |
|
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Neurologic diseases | 68 (8.0) | 411 (4.8) | 1.7 (1.3; 2.2) | 0.0002 | 1.1 (0.8; 1.5) | 0.38 |
| Infectious and parasitic diseases | 181 (21.3) | 1394 (16.4) | 1.4 (1.2; 1.6) | 0.0005 | 1.1 (0.9; 1.4) | 0.20 |
| Immune system disorders | <4 | 20 (0.2) | NA | — | NA | — |
| Respiratory diseases | 254 (29.9) | 1941 (22.8) | 1.4 (1.2; 1.7) | 0.0001 | 1.3 (1.1; 1.5) | 0.004 |
| Gastrointestinal disorders | 120 (14.1) | 903 (10.6) | 1.4 (1.1; 1.7) | 0.0053 | 1.1 (0.9; 1.4) | 0.82 |
| Skin and subcutaneous tissue disorders | 133 (15.7) | 926 (10.9) | 1.5 (1.2; 1.8) | 0.0001 | 1.3 (1.1; 1.6) | 0.014 |
| Musculoskeletal system and connective tissues diseases | 178 (20.9) | 1156 (13.6) | 1.7 (1.4; 2.0) | 0.0002 | 1.5 (1.3; 1.9) | 0.0002 |
| Genitourinary system diseases | 39 (4.6) | 285 (3.4) | 1.4 (1.0; 2.0) | 0.09 | 1.2 (0.8; 1.7) | 0.42 |
| Circulatory system diseases | 42 (4.9) | 217 (2.6) | 1.9 (1.3; 2.7) | 0.0006 | 1.6 (1.1; 2.4) | 0.02 |
| Endocrine system diseases (excluding diabetes mellitus) | 84 (9.9) | 341 (4.0) | 1.8 (1.3; 2.4) | 0.0003 | 1.5 (1.0; 2.0) | 0.04 |
| Diabetes mellitus | 40 (4.7) | 74 (0.9) | 5.7 (3.8; 8.7) | 0.0002 | 5.8 (3.6; 9.4) | 0.0002 |
| Congenital malformations | 37 (4.4) | 327 (3.9) | 1.1 (0.8; 1.6) | 0.50 | 1.1 (0.7; 1.5) | 0.77 |
| Injury, poisoning and external causes of morbidity and mortality (excluding suicide) | 402 (47.3) | 3154 (37.1) | 1.5 (1.3; 1.8) | 0.0001 | 1.1 (1.0; 1.3) | 0.15 |
Cell size < 5, analysis not applied. Psychiatric comorbidity refers to any lifetime psychiatric disorder or suicide‐related behavior recorded in the National Patient Register. Controls were matched to cases on sex and year, month, and county of birth. AOR = adjusted odds ratio, CI = confidence interval, OR = odds ratio.
p values adjusted by the method of false discovery rate.
Results of logistic regression evaluating the association of obesity (BMI ≥ 30) with each outcome, controlling for sex, county, and year of birtha
| Somatic Illness Category | OR (95% CI) |
|
|---|---|---|
| Neurologic diseases | 0.8 (0.5; 1.4) | 0.47 |
| Infectious and parasitic diseases | 1.1 (0.7; 1.5) | 0.77 |
| Immune system disorders | NA | — |
| Respiratory diseases | 1.5 (1.1; 2.1) | 0.017 |
| Gastrointestinal disorders | 2.7 (1.7; 4.2) | 0.0005 |
| Skin and subcutaneous tissue disorders | 1.6 (1.1; 2.4) | 0.021 |
| Musculoskeletal system and connective tissues diseases | 1.1 (0.8; 1.6) | 0.82 |
| Genitourinary system diseases | 1.1 (0.6; 2.3) | 0.74 |
| Circulatory system diseases | 1.4 (0.7; 2.9) | 0.82 |
| Endocrine system diseases (excluding diabetes mellitus) | 1.0 (0.5; 1.8) | 0.82 |
| Diabetes mellitus | 0.9 (0.4; 1.9) | 0.82 |
| Injury, poisoning and external causes of morbidity and mortality (excluding suicide) | 1.3 (0.9; 1.7) | 0.12 |
Total N = 850; 361 comorbid obesity, 489 no comorbid obesity.
Note: analyses for congenital malformations were conducted using exact logistic regression models controlling only for age group: OR (95% CI): 0.3 (0.1; 0.7), p < 0.004.
County of birth was grouped according to region: north, middle, south, outside Sweden; year of birth was grouped as: 1965 and earlier, 1966–1975, 1976–1985, 1986 and later.
Cell size < 5, analysis not applied.
Exact logistic regression analyses conducted controlling only for age group.
p values adjusted by the method of false discovery rate.
